Product Attributes
- Product Status: Active
- Adapter Type: Plug to Jack
- Conversion Type: Between Series
- Adapter Series: 7/16 DIN to 4.3/10
- Center Gender: Female to Male
- Convert From (Adapter End): 4.3/10 Plug, Male Pin
- Convert To (Adapter End): 7/16 Jack, Female Socket
- Impedance: 50Ohm
- Style: Straight
- Mounting Type: Free Hanging (In-Line)
- Mounting Feature: -
- Fastening Type: Threaded, Threaded
- Frequency - Max: 6 GHz
- Ingress Protection: -
- Center Contact Plating: Silver
